The city of Pflugerville is hosting an open house meeting on its Windermere Drive and Heatherwilde Boulevard road projects Oct. 19 from 5:30-7 p.m. at the Windermere Clubhouse, located at 16800 Gower St.

Reconstruction efforts are planned for January. Throughout the project, various driveway and home access points will be impacted with neighborhood street closures ongoing, according to the city.

Streets that will be affected include:

  • Cactus Blossom Drive

  • Columbine Street

  • Ardisia Drive

  • Simsbrook Drive

  • Dashwood Creek Drive

  • Blackthorn Drive

  • Thackeray Lane

  • Gravesbend Road

  • Isle of Man Road

  • Isle of Man Court

  • Gower Street

  • Langland Road


The project will require an investment of $5 million to repair curbs, sidewalks and roadways on the 2 1/2 miles of roadway.

The open house event will allow residents to ask questions and converse about the impact the project will have. More information on the project will be posted here by the city.
